Frequently Asked Questions - VIP-462DG Planet

How do I connect the Planet VIP-462DG router to the internet?
Connect the WAN port of the router to your modem or internet source using an Ethernet cable. Connect a computer to one of the LAN ports, power on the router, and access the web interface by entering 192.168.1.1 in your browser. Follow the built-in setup wizard to configure your internet connection.
What is the default IP address and login credentials?
The default IP address is 192.168.1.1. The default username is admin and the default password is admin. We strongly recommend changing the password after initial setup for security.
How do I change the Wi-Fi password?
Log into the web interface, go to Wireless Settings, and select the SSID you want to configure (2.4 GHz or 5 GHz). Enter a new password in the Pre-Shared Key field, choose WPA2-PSK or WPA3-SAE as the encryption, and click Save. Reconnect your devices with the new password.
How can I reset the router to factory defaults?
With the router powered on, use a pin or paperclip to press and hold the Reset button for about 10 seconds until the power LED blinks. Release the button. The router will reboot with factory settings. Alternatively, use the web interface: System Management > Factory Defaults.
How do I configure parental controls or access restrictions?
Access the web interface and navigate to Access Control or Parental Control. You can filter by MAC address, IP address, or URL keywords. Set a schedule for internet access and apply rules to specific devices connected to the router.
How do I update the firmware on my Planet VIP-462DG?
Download the latest firmware from the Planet official website. In the web interface, go to System Management > Firmware Upgrade, choose the downloaded file, and click Upgrade. Do not disconnect the power during the upgrade process.
Why is my Wi-Fi signal weak and how can I improve it?
The signal can be weakened by distance, walls, and interference from electronic devices. Place the router in a central, elevated location away from obstructions. Ensure the antennas are perpendicular for best coverage. You can also adjust the channel or enable Quality of Service (QoS) to prioritize bandwidth.
How do I set up a guest network?
In the web interface, go to Wireless Settings > Guest Network, enable it, create a separate SSID, and set an encryption method. This isolates guests from your main network while providing internet access.
What do the LEDs on the front panel indicate?
The Power LED shows system status. Each LAN LED corresponds to a wired port and blinks when data is transferred. The WAN LED indicates the internet connection status. Wi-Fi LEDs show whether the 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z bands are active. WPS LED flashes during WPS pairing.
Can I use this router with a DSL modem or fiber ONT?
Yes, the WAN port is Ethernet-based and supports connections to DSL/ADSL modems, cable modems, fiber ONTs, or any passive Ethernet connection. You may need to configure the WAN connection type (PPPoE, DHCP, static IP) according to your internet service.
